The Pretoria High Court sentenced Onthatile Sebati for planning the death of her father, mother and two siblings in 2016 and enlisting the help of two men.
Onthatile Sebati was found guilty of murder, robbery with aggravated circumstances and possession of a firearm and ammunition after she got her cousins to help her commit the deedNetizens were disgruntled that a woman who planned her family's death would serve four life sentences concurrently. Sudan Army Enters North Khartoum, Darfur Joint Force Combs North Darfur CapitalFighting between the Sudan Armed Forces (SAF) and the Rapid Support Forces (RSF) continued this morning in El Mogran in northwestern Khartoum. Army troops entered Khartoum North, pushing the paramilitaries southwards. Fighting was also reported from other places in Khartoum state, and from areas north of the capital.
